Description Calvin Tennant 2014-05-28 08:09:14 PDT
The bug occurs regularly on https://www.checkout51.com/terms

When scrolling on a web page, text cuts off half way down. As soon as the user interacts with the page the text pops back into view.
This issue does not occur in other browsers. It seems to be intermittent in Safari. I have reproduced it on multiple computers in our office. 

I have uploaded a video of the bug occurring here: 
https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=PaMqWkdNcoQ

You'll notice during the video that the mouse cursor changes from the default cursor to the text cursor while scrolling over invisible paragraphs.
